Class ExternalConnectionCollection
Namespace: Aspose.Cells.ExternalConnections
Assembly: Aspose.Cells.dll (25.2.0)
Specifies the Aspose.Cells.ExternalConnections.ExternalConnection collection
public class ExternalConnectionCollection : CollectionBase<externalconnection>, IList<externalconnection>, ICollection<externalconnection>, IEnumerable<externalconnection>, ICollection, IEnumerable
Inheritance
object ← CollectionBase<externalconnection> ← ExternalConnectionCollection
Implements
IList<externalconnection>, ICollection<externalconnection>, IEnumerable<externalconnection>, ICollection, IEnumerable
Inherited Members
CollectionBase<externalconnection>.BinarySearch(ExternalConnection), CollectionBase<externalconnection>.BinarySearch(ExternalConnection, IComparer<externalconnection>), CollectionBase<externalconnection>.BinarySearch(int, int, ExternalConnection, IComparer<externalconnection>), CollectionBase<externalconnection>.Contains(ExternalConnection), CollectionBase<externalconnection>.CopyTo(ExternalConnection[]), CollectionBase<externalconnection>.CopyTo(ExternalConnection[], int), CollectionBase<externalconnection>.CopyTo(int, ExternalConnection[], int, int), CollectionBase<externalconnection>.Exists(Predicate<externalconnection>), CollectionBase<externalconnection>.Find(Predicate<externalconnection>), CollectionBase<externalconnection>.FindAll(Predicate<externalconnection>), CollectionBase<externalconnection>.FindIndex(Predicate<externalconnection>), CollectionBase<externalconnection>.FindIndex(int, Predicate<externalconnection>), CollectionBase<externalconnection>.FindIndex(int, int, Predicate<externalconnection>), CollectionBase<externalconnection>.FindLast(Predicate<externalconnection>), CollectionBase<externalconnection>.FindLastIndex(Predicate<externalconnection>), CollectionBase<externalconnection>.FindLastIndex(int, Predicate<externalconnection>), CollectionBase<externalconnection>.FindLastIndex(int, int, Predicate<externalconnection>), CollectionBase<externalconnection>.IndexOf(ExternalConnection), CollectionBase<externalconnection>.IndexOf(ExternalConnection, int), CollectionBase<externalconnection>.IndexOf(ExternalConnection, int, int), CollectionBase<externalconnection>.LastIndexOf(ExternalConnection), CollectionBase<externalconnection>.LastIndexOf(ExternalConnection, int), CollectionBase<externalconnection>.LastIndexOf(ExternalConnection, int, int), CollectionBase<externalconnection>.GetEnumerator(), CollectionBase<externalconnection>.Clear(), CollectionBase<externalconnection>.RemoveAt(int), CollectionBase<externalconnection>.OnClearComplete(), CollectionBase<externalconnection>.OnClear(), CollectionBase<externalconnection>.Capacity, CollectionBase<externalconnection>.Count, CollectionBase<externalconnection>.InnerList, CollectionBase<externalconnection>.this[int], object.GetType(), object.MemberwiseClone(), object.ToString(), object.Equals(object?), object.Equals(object?, object?), object.ReferenceEquals(object?, object?), object.GetHashCode()
Examples
Workbook wb = new Workbook("connection.xlsx");
ExternalConnectionCollection dataConns = wb.DataConnections;
ExternalConnection dataConn = null;
for (int i = 0; i < dataConns.Count; i++)
{
dataConn = dataConns[i];
//get external connection id
Console.WriteLine(dataConn.ConnectionId);
}
Dim wb As Workbook = New Workbook("connection.xlsx")
Dim dataConns As ExternalConnectionCollection = wb.DataConnections
Dim dataConn As ExternalConnection
Dim count As Integer = dataConns.Count - 1
Dim i As Integer
For i = 0 To count Step 1
dataConn = dataConns(i)
'get external connection id
Console.WriteLine(dataConn.ConnectionId)
Next
Properties
this[int]
Gets the Aspose.Cells.ExternalConnections.ExternalConnection element at the specified index.
public ExternalConnection this[int index] { get; set; }
Property Value
this[string]
Gets the Aspose.Cells.ExternalConnections.ExternalConnection element with the specified name.
public ExternalConnection this[string connectionName] { get; }
Property Value
Methods
GetExternalConnectionById(int)
Gets the Aspose.Cells.ExternalConnections.ExternalConnection element with the specified id.
public ExternalConnection GetExternalConnectionById(int connId)
Parameters
connId
int
external connection id
Returns
The element with the specified id. </extern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ection></externalconnection>